Mature Athletes Darwin offers track and field athletics for the ‘mature’ with most of our members being over 50.
Running, race walking, jumping and throwing for fun and fitness. All levels of ability welcome. We meet throughout the year to train, compete and socialise.
Training: 4.30pm, Wednesday and Sunday at Marrara Athletics Stadium

In 1996, Nola Brockie travelled to Alice Springs to ‘suss out’ the Masters’ Games and decided, yes can do this.
Eighteen months of regularly ringing the NT Athletics office requesting a coach for ‘mature athletes’ resulted in Jennie Duffield stepping forward and accepting the challenge. In June 1998, Sunday afternoon training began.
This small group consisting of Nola, Ruth Garden, Elaine Holmes, Darryl Manzie and Bernie Trinne, competed in the NT Championships in 1998 followed by the Alice Springs Masters Games, marking the first time a team had represented Darwin in athletics at the Games.
Gaining confidence and success at the 1999 NT Championships, on 28 November 1999, over lunch at Stokes Hill Wharf, a steering committee was formed to officially launch an athletics club for mature athletes. MAD Frogs was spawned in 2000.
